Analysis: Unpacking Delta's Q2 2025 Triumph
Delta Air Lines delivered a standout performance in the second quarter of 2025, with key financial metrics like adjusted earnings per share (EPS) and total operating revenue significantly exceeding analyst forecasts. This strong showing indicates that the airline successfully capitalized on sustained robust demand for air travel, particularly within premium segments and international routes, contributing to its profitability.
The stellar results were primarily driven by continued strength in both leisure and business travel, coupled with effective capacity management and yield optimization strategies. Delta's persistent focus on its premium product offerings, including Delta One and First Class, proved especially lucrative, contributing disproportionately to the overall revenue growth. Furthermore, diligent cost controls and potentially favorable fuel hedging strategies likely played a crucial role in boosting the airline's bottom line.
The market's enthusiastic response, evidenced by the immediate surge in Delta's share price, underscores strong investor confidence in the airline's strategic direction and its ability to navigate the complex post-pandemic aviation landscape. This earnings beat not only solidifies Delta's financial position but also sets a positive tone for the broader airline industry, suggesting that a healthy appetite for travel continues to fuel robust sector profitability.
